| + | === Usage === | ||
| + | |||
| + | When you log into a Nomachine session, it's just like you are logging in to any of our Linux servers. | ||
| + | |||
| + | Most common linux software is already installed and available on these servers. Take a look at our [[software_modules|software modules page]] for more information. | ||
